Verse (40:61), Word 20 - Quranic Grammar

__

The twentieth word of verse (40:61) is divided into 2 morphological segments. A verb and subject pronoun. The imperfect verb (فعل مضارع) is third person masculine plural and is in the indicative mood (مرفوع). The verb's triliteral root is shīn kāf rā (ش ك ر). The suffix (الواو) is an attached subject pronoun.

Verse (40:61)

The analysis above refers to the 61st verse of chapter 40 (sūrat ghāfir):

Sahih International: It is Allah who made for you the night that you may rest therein and the day giving sight. Indeed, Allah is full of bounty to the people, but most of the people are not grateful.
